Eric Mumba Monga
With over thirty years of experience for clients in the mining sector, Eric brings the level of expertise needed for such an ambitious initiative. As a native Congolese with a firm belief of the important role that energy plays in every aspect of Congolese economic development. In 2001, he founded Trade Service, a design and logistics firm that focuses on taxation, facilitation of trade and customs clearance agency, for which he currently serves as Chairman of the Board of Directors. In 2012, Eric established DRCMCS, an independent mining consultancy firm in Lubumbashi and registered in New York, which offers a wide range of services exclusively for the international mining and metallurgical industry and Companies affiliated to the exploitation of raw materials. He is regularly invited to leading international conferences such as Africa CEO Forum and the annual conference of the Clinton Global Initiative as an expert in issues about the DRC. Eric currently serves as the vice President of the Federation of Enterprises of Congo (FEC) and the leader of the National Committee on Energy. He has extensive experience in the Congolese economic sector and is member of several associations worldwide.
